## Tax-Rate Lookup Cache

The Copperdale service caches jurisdiction tax rates in an in-memory LRU with a 24-hour TTL, refreshed nightly from the Marleyfort rates feed. Never bypass the cache in request paths; stale entries are acceptable per finance policy. Manual invalidation requires a change ticket. For cache questions or invalidation requests, write to the address below.

escalation mailbox, hafop-fahop: ralix_oliael@qirvanlabs.internal

Subject: Key rotation for the FareSplit pricing experiment

Hey Priya — quick heads up before you review my branch. We rotated the credentials for the Tixwell pricing sandbox, so the old key in the experiment config is dead. The variant bucketing service (and the FareSplit dashboard) now expect the new one. Update your local env before running the integration suite. Here's the new key for the sandbox service.

gateway credential: kto23_dolYgAScEh2TaPOlStqOl98

**Q: An export failed in Cartwheel — how do I retry it?**

Most export failures in Cartwheel are transient, usually a timeout against the Fennick warehouse. Open the Exports panel, find the failed job, and click Retry; the job resumes from its last committed chunk, so no duplicates are created. If three retries fail, escalate to the data platform rotation rather than retrying further. Retrying a job older than seven days requires unlocking the archive queue, which prompts for the recovery passphrase shown below.

recovery phrase for bawep-kawef: oliath-casdor